Tony Jefferson (Chula Vista, Calif./Eastlake) is one of the top defensive players in the West region. He recently set up his first two official visits and knows where his final three visits will be as well.
Jefferson is a standout linebacker-safety but said he's being recruited exclusively at safety right now. He just started summer school on Wednesday and plans to graduate a semester early and enroll at his school of choice in January.
"I have my first two visits lined up right now," Jefferson said. "I'm going to Florida (Sept. 18) and Oklahoma (Nov. 13). My last three visits will be to Notre Dame, Michigan and Penn State and I'll do unofficial visits to USC and UCLA.
"I'm really looking forward to seeing these out of state schools because I've heard so much about them but have never visited anywhere outside of the in-state schools. Right now, I'm open to all of them and no one leads right now. My trips and how the teams do on the field this year will play a big role."
Early playing time is another big factor for Jefferson.
"I want to go somewhere and play as a true freshman," Jefferson said. "The only school I'm not sure I'll be able to do that at because of how much safety depth they have is USC. They were my big early leader but I'm opening things back up now and giving all the schools a real, hard look.
"I like what all the schools are telling me and UCLA is coming on strong too. So this is going to be a really tough decision for me. I thought it would be easy but not anymore and with me graduating early, I don't have as much time to figure it all out."
